医院药品管理系统的设计与实现.doc
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_05.gif)
《医院药品管理系统的设计与实现.doc》由会员分享,可在线阅读,更多相关《医院药品管理系统的设计与实现.doc(65页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、 中国矿业大学徐海学院本科生毕业设计姓 名: 程国升 学 号: 22090105 学 院: 徐海学院 专 业:自动化设计题目:医院药品进销存管理系统设计与实现专 题:指导教师: 周林娜 职 称: 讲师 2013年 6 月 中国矿业大学徐海学院毕业论文任务书专业年级 自动化09级 学号 22090105 学生 程国升 任务下达日期:2012年 12月 14日毕业论文日期:2012 年 12月 20日至2013年 6 月 15 日毕业论文题目:医院药品进销存管理系统设计与实现毕业论文专题题目:毕业论文主要容和要求:针对某一具体企业,描述其目前进销存管理现状与需求情况,根据系统规模选择系统开发工具和
2、系统开发方法(结构化方法、面向对象方法、原型法等),对系统进行需求分析、可行性分析、功能分析与数据结构分析、数据流程分析,在系统分析基础上对系统进行设计,实现系统并进行测试。指导教师签字: 重 声 明本人所呈交的毕业论文,是在导师的指导下,独立进行研究所取得的成果。所有数据、图片资料真实可靠。尽我所知,除文中已经注明引用的容外,本毕业论文的研究成果不包含他人享有著作权的容。对本论文所涉与的研究工作做出贡献的其他个人和集体,均已在文中以明确的方式标明。本论文属于原创。本毕业论文的知识产权归属于培养单位。本人签名: 日期: 中国矿业大学徐海学院毕业论文指导教师评阅书指导教师评语(基础理论与基本技能
3、的掌握;独立解决实际问题的能力;研究容的理论依据和技术方法;取得的主要成果与创新点;工作态度与工作量;总体评价与建议成绩;存在问题;是否同意答辩等):成 绩: 指导教师签字: 年 月 日中国矿业大学徐海学院毕业论文评阅教师评阅书评阅教师评语(选题的意义;基础理论与基本技能的掌握;综合运用所学知识解决实际问题的能力;工作量的大小;取得的主要成果与创新点;写作的规程度;总体评价与建议成绩;存在问题;是否同意答辩等):成 绩: 评阅教师签字: 年 月 日中国矿业大学徐海学院毕业论文答辩与综合成绩答 辩 情 况提 出 问 题回 答 问 题正 确基本正确有一般性错误有原则性错误没有回答答辩委员会评语与建
4、议成绩:答辩委员会主任签字: 年 月 日学院领导小组综合评定成绩:学院领导小组负责人: 年 月 日摘 要医药卫生体制的不断改革,促进了医院信息管理系统(HIS)在全国围的普与,医院药品管理系统作为信息管理系统的重要组成部分之一,越来越引起大家的关注。医院药品管理系统有着举足轻重的作用,因此需要加大对其管理力度,促使药品的管理更加规、标准,从各个环节对医院药品进行统一、规的管理,促进更多管理系统的出现,促使我国的医疗卫生行业更加的规标准,效率得到极大的提高,更加符合国际标准。但是目前药品管理系统中存在着一定的问题,如:库存管理不到位出现药品的积压;医院不能与时对药品的价格进行调整,使其随着市场上
5、药品的价格变化;药品管理系统不能根据已有的药品与有关信息,进行药品预测分析,给管理人员提供药品消耗、药品的规律变化等给出所需的决策支持信息,因此更加智能化、能够进行决策支持的系统才是社会所需要的。本系统以Microsoft Visual Studio 2008为平台,主要使用图形化方式实现前台界面,以SQL Server 2005为后台数据库,实现了药品管理系统的药品入出库管理、采购和销售管理、库存管理。关键词:医院药品管理; 医院信息管理系统(HIS); SQL Server 2005ABSTRACTWith the medical and health system reform,prom
6、oting the management of the hospital information system in the nationwide population. As one part of HIS, hospital drug management has been paid more and more attention.Hospital drugs management system is so important that we must strength its management to make it more standard. To all aspects of t
7、he hospital drugs , we should make unified management so that more software will come true and our countrys medical and health industry will more normative, greatly increasing the efficiency. But now there are some problems, such as: the emergence of drug stockpiles; drug prices can not follow with
8、the change in the market; there is no analysis and forecasting of existing information to assist making decision. Therefore, more intelligent decision support system is what the community needs. This system combine usage Microsoft Visual Studio 2008 developing platform and SQL Server 2005 database,
9、carried out a drugs information management: the inventory management, drugs management and database list stores in warehouse a list management, procurement and sales management, andforecasting analysis of existing information.Keywords: Hospital Information Management System; Hospital Drug Management
10、; SQL 200555 / 65目 录第一章概论11.1 设计的背景与意义11.2完成的工作与创新点2第二章软件的介绍与基本原理32.1 Microsoft Visual Studio 2008介绍32.2 SQL Server 2005 简介32.3 基于客户机/服务器(C/S)体系结构32.4 C#高级程序设计语言4第三章系统分析53.1 可行性分析53.2 需求分析63.2.1系统的目的63.2.2 功能需求63.2.3 用户需求73.2.4 系统业务流程分析73.2.5 数据流程分析73.2.6 数据字典(DD)73.2.7 外部接口需求12第四章系统设计134.1 系统功能描述13
11、4.2 系统整体结构134.3 概念结构设计144.4 数据库的逻辑设计154.4.1 数据库各表154.4.2 系统设计204.4.3 方式21第五章药品管理系统的实现255.1 登录的实现255.2 系统子模块实现26第六章系统测试和维护306.1 测试计划306.2系统调试306.3系统测试306.4系统的维护31结论33参考文献35附录36翻译部分42英文原文42中文译文48致54第一章 概论通过利用现代信息技术使得医院具有更加快速高效的效率和更加灵活的市场反应能力,跟上社会信息化的趋势,是我们现在所关注的问题。而医院的药品管理系统与其他方面息息相关,建立一个功能齐备的药品管理系统来促
12、使医院药品的管理工作更加规化、自动化、标准化,从而提高医院的管理效率。进一步的要能够根据系统中现有的信息,进行分析预测提出对未来或者近期药品的消耗、用药趋势等,帮助管理者进行决策才是系统的发展趋势。本系统充分利用现有的软硬件环境和先进的管理系统开发方案,以尽量满足功能需求和性能需求为目的;系统采用模块化的程序设计方法,这样既有利于模块的开发和功能的组合,又有利于其他人员对系统的快速熟悉和使用;系统还要具备数据库维护功能,能实现基本的增删改操作,还要求能对仓库中药品存在的问题给出与时的提示功能。1.1 设计的背景与意义计算机技术的快速发展,使得其在管理系统中发挥着越来越重要的作用,促进了管理系统
13、的规化和标准化,而且极提高了系统的效率。医院药品管理系统是医院信息管理系统的一个重要组成部分。由于对药品的管理是一项十分复杂、繁琐,但是准确度要求极高不允许出错的工作,医院药品管理系统的引进解决了这个问题。计算机在系统管理中的应用越来越普与,利用计算机实现各个系统的管理显得越来越重要,已成为推动管理走向科学化、规化的必要条件。药库管理是一项琐碎、复杂、而且细致的工作,如果手工操作,药品种类和数量,市场价格资料等,这些数据会花掉人们大量的时间和精力。如果使用计算机代替人进行相关的操作,不仅能够保证运算的精确快速,更能节省大量的时间。还可以利用计算机进行相关的统计,分析工作。医院中的药库管理、财务
14、管理、信息整理,一直是手工完成,随着产业结构的调整,在全新的市场竞争环境下,为了提高运营效率,利用计算机辅助是使医药管理迈向科学化和规化的明智选择。本系统主要是药品信息管理的库存管理、采购管理、销售管理和用户管理等模块的功能实现,使用.NET技术与SQL Server数据库技术加以实现。使系统能够进行用户权限和密码的更改,保证系统的安全性;实现药品采购和销售的管理生成记录详细的采购单、入库单和销售单,方便查询每种药品的流入和流出;实现对库存的管理,与时的了解库存状况和库存信息,有效的进行库存的管理;实现预测分析得到决策时所需信息,辅助管理者进行决策。1.2完成的工作与创新点1、完成的工作本系统
15、以Microsoft Visual Studio 2008为平台,以SQL Server 2005为后台数据库,实现了药品管理系统的药品入出库管理、采购和销售管理、库存管理,以与药品信息的分析预测功能。并且在指导老师的指导下使论文更加的规、标准。现在所制作的系统也可完成预想的部分功能,但是还是需要很多后期的工作来实现更多的需求和功能。目前系统能完成基础药品信息的查询,进行药品的增加、删除、修改操作。还看对药品的入库和出库、采购和销售、库存进行管理实现相应的功能。并且能够对数据进行简单的分析处理工作,给出相应的预测信息,帮助管理人员进行决策。论文对所进行的工作有一个系统的描述。2、 系统特点1)
16、界面清晰,简单易懂,功能齐全,使用起来非常的便捷。2)系统很好的应用了检索功能,使输入变得简单,提高了速度。3)利用计算机技术,大大提高了工作效率。3、创新点通过对数据库中现有的信息进行预测分析,帮助管理者进行决策或者是对管理者的决策提供一定的辅助信息。如:根据近期的药品消耗规律对药品的采购提前给出信息;根据病人对各种药品使用后的患者反应来决定采购时要采购哪家生产厂家的产品;以与对那些反应极差的药品要设置提示信息,避免以后再采购这个厂家的药品。4、系统可实现的目标1)提高了医院的管理水平,以与各种药品的详细记录各种统计报表。2)让人们不再从事繁重且复杂的劳动,节省医药管理人员的工作效率和时间。
17、3)利用计算机操作,保证药品价格的准确合理,可根据相关信息与时处理药品价格变动。4)安全可靠的保存庞大的数据信息。第二章 软件的介绍与基本原理2.1 Microsoft Visual Studio 2008介绍Microsoft Visual Studio 2008是面向Windows Vista、Office 2007、Web 2.0的下一代开发工具,代号“Orcas”,是对Visual Studio 2005 一次与时、全面的升级。 VS2008引入了250多个新特性,整合了对象、关系型数据、XML的访问方式,语言更加简洁。使用Visual Studio 2008可以高效开发Windows
18、应用。设计器中可以实时反映变更,XAML中智能感知功能可以提高开发效率。同时Visual Studio 2008支持项目模板、调试器和部署程序。Visual Studio 2008可以高效开发Web应用,集成了AJAX 1.0,包含AJAX项目模板,它还可以高效开发Office应用和Mobile应用。2.2 SQL Server 2005 简介SQL Server 2005是微软公司开发的一种数据库,它在SQL Server 2000的基础上改进了数据分区、安全、可编程性以与语言增强等方面,既有SQL Server 2005的有点又有长足的进步。而这一点从借助浏览器实现数据库查询功能到有着丰富
19、容的扩展性标记语言(XML)支持特性都可以有利的证明这一点:SQL Server 2005全面支持对于数据库的解决方案。与此同时,SQL Server 2005可以在激烈市场竞争中能够胜出的原因就是因为SQL Server 2005在可靠性与可伸缩性方面保持着多项基准测试记录。SQL Server 2005在以事务处理运行速度和以应用程序开发速度的衡量的角度来看,都可以称之为最快捷方便的数据库系统。2.3 基于客户机/服务器(C/S)体系结构C/S体系结构与其特点C/S体系结构是20世纪80年代逐渐成长起来,是在计算机网络和分布式计算基础上的一种局域网络结构模式。在C/S体系结构中应用程序逻辑
20、通常分布在客户和服务器两端:服务器后端主要是用来处理业务逻辑和数据处理,客户机前端处理用户的界面和交互的容,服务器和客户机有各自不同的任务,但是又相互协同工作。客户机向服务器发送服务请求,服务器接受请求并且进行处理,并将处理结果传送给客户机。采用C/S体系结构具有以下优点:(1)因为应用程序是在客户机上运行的,所以当有需要对数据库中的数据进行操作时,客户程序就会自动的查找服务器程序,并且想起发出相应的请求,这时服务器收到该请求,服务器程序会根据预订的规则作出应答,因此服务器运行数据负荷就会减轻。(2)C/S体系结构可以解决很复杂的事务逻辑。(3)该体系结构通过将人、物合理的分配到客户端和服务器
21、端,大大降低了系统的通讯开销,并且充分的利用了这两端硬件环境的优势。(4)从技术成熟度和软件设计上讲,C/S技术应用更加成熟、可靠。而且发展历史更为“悠久”。2.4 C#高级程序设计语言C#读作C Ssharp。是由C和C+衍生出来的面向对象的编程语言,是一种安全的、稳定的、简单的、优雅的。C#结合了VB的简单的可视化操作和C+的高运行效率,它在继承了C和C+的强大功能的同时也去掉了一些它们的复杂特性(例如没有宏以与不允许多重继承),C#以先进的语法风格、便捷的面向组件编程、方便的操作能力和创新的语言特性的支持成为了本系统开发的首选语言。正是由于C#的卓越设计是面向对象的方式,在构建各类组件时
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 医院 药品 管理 系统 设计 实现
![提示](https://www.taowenge.com/images/bang_tan.gif)
限制150内